Poland is a village in eastern Mahoning County, Ohio, United States. The population was 2,463 at the 2020 census . [ 4 ] A suburb about 7 miles (11 km) south of Youngstown , it is part of the Youngstown–Warren metropolitan area .

Struthers is located on the banks of the Mahoning River about 4 miles (6.4 km) west of the border between Ohio and Pennsylvania at the intersection of Ohio State Route 616 and Ohio State Route 289. The larger part of the city is across the river from State Route 289 on the south side of the river.
